摘要

目的 研究不同品种饲用油菜(饲油1号、15-P15、金油158、12-P38、华协11、华油杂62)在不同土壤条件下的株高、干物质及营养成分变化,筛选出适合本地区不同土壤条件的饲用油菜品种。 方法 根据不同土壤特性,分别选择中性土地、碱性土壤、风沙土地进行油菜品种种植试验,测定饲用油菜株高、干物质含量、粗蛋白、中性洗涤纤维、酸性洗涤纤维,分析其生物特性和营养成分与土壤条件的相关性。 结果 不同土壤条件下,油菜株高以华油杂62最高,在中性土壤中为145 cm,在碱性土壤中为142 cm,在沙化土壤中为137 cm。不同品种间油菜干物质,在中性土壤中以华油杂62最高,为70.36%;在碱性土壤中以华油杂62最高,为69.25%;在沙化土壤中以华协11最高,为69.18%。油菜粗蛋白含量,在中性土壤中以华油杂62最高,为3.57%;在碱性土壤中以华油杂62最高,为3.14%;在沙化土壤中以华协11最高,为2.84%。不同品种间中性洗涤纤维含量,在中性土壤中以华油杂62最高,为85.06%;在碱性土壤中以华油杂62最高,为84.31%;在沙化土壤中以华协11最高,为82.57%。在3种土壤条件下,华油杂62、华协11的株高及营养成分均较高。 结论 在吉林西部地区的碱性土壤和沙化土壤中华油杂62及华协11均具有较好的适应性,可以在吉林西部种植。

Abstract

Objectives 6 rapeseed varieties including Shiyou 1, 15-P15, Jinyou 158, 12-P38, Huaxie 11, and Huayouza 62 were used to study the changes in plant height, dry matter, and nutrient composition under different soil conditions to screen suitable rapeseed varieties for different soil conditions in the local area. Methods The neutral soil, alkaline soil, and sandy soil were selected to plant rapeseed varieties according to soil characteristics. Measure The plant height, the content of dry matter, crude protein, neutral detergent fiber, and acidic detergent fiber of rapeseed were measured. The correlation between its biological characteristics and nutritional components and soil conditions was analyzed. Results The plant height of Huayouza 62 was the highest under different soil conditions, which was 145 cm in neutral soil, 142 cm in alkaline soil, and 137 cm in sandy soil. The content of dry matter in Huayouzao 62 in neutral soil was the highest (70.36%). The content of dry matter in Huayu Zao 62 in alkaline soil was the highest (69.18%). The content of crude protein in Huayouzao 62 in neutral and alkaline soil was the highest (3.57% and 3.14%). The content of crude protein in Huaxia 11 in sandy soil was the highest (2.84%). The content of neutral detergent fiber in Huayouzao 62 in the neutral and alkaline soil was the highest (85.06% and 84.31%). The content of neutral detergent fiber in Huaxia 11 in sandy soil was the highest (82.57%). The plant height and nutrient content of Huayouza 62 and Huaxie 11 under the three soil conditions were higher. Conclusions Both Huayouza62 and Huaxie 11 have good adaptability in alkaline and sandy soil in western Jilin, and can be planted in western Jilin.
